Ingredients

The following ingredients have 12 Servings
  • 8 ounce package Pillsbury crescent rolls
  • 1 Tablespoon mayonnaise
  • 1 teaspoon yellow mustard
  • optional 1/2 teaspoon prepared horseradish (my kids couldn't tell this was in there but it gives it a kick of flavor)
  • 6 ounces of sliced deli ham
  • 1 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ese

Instruction

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ray cookie sheet with cooking spray.
  • Unroll crescent dough onto cookie sheet and press the perforations together to seal them.
  • In a small bowl, mix together the mayonnaise, mustard, and horseradish. Brush over crescent dough in an even layer.
  • Layer the ham on top evenly.
  • Sprinkle the cheddar cheese evenly on top.
  • Beginning with the longest edge, roll up the filling and dough.
  • Slice with a sharp knife into 1/2 inch slices. For even easier cutting, place the roll in the freezer for about 15 minutes to firm up before slicing.
  • Place slices on the cookie sheet and bake for 10-14 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Cool for a minute then enjoy. My kids liked dipping their pinwheels in ranch!
